THORChain is a liquidity protocol based on Tendermint & Cosmos-SDK and utilising Threshold Signature Schemes (TSS) to create a marketplace of liquidity for digital assets to be traded in a trustless, permissionless & non-custodial manner. THORChain's liquidity marketplace design obviates the need for order book exchanges when simply swapping one asset for another and provides ancillary benefits including manipulation resistance & on-chain price feeds. THORChain is able to remain chain-agnostic, favoring no specific asset or blockchain and able to scale without sacrificing security
